Cranberry Peach Oatmeal Kugel Recipe

Servings: 6

Ingredients

  • 1 can Whole cranberry sauce
  • 1 can (16 ounce.) sliced peaches, without the juice [I used the peaches in light juice, 60% less calories, no corn syrup]
  • 2 c. Uncooked oatmeal
  • 3/4 c. Flour
  • 3/4 c. Oil (I used 1/4, it was OK, but next time I'll try 1/3 c.)
  • 1 tsp Cinnamon
  • 3/4 c. Brown sugar (I used 1/4 c. and thought it was fine)

Directions

  1. Serves 6-8 people (unless one is smitten by its taste and hogs it all!)
  2. Mix dry ingredients plus oil. Grease 8-inch square pan. Spread half of dry ingredients in pan. In separate bowl, drain peaches and mix with cranberry sauce. Pour which mix into the pan. Add in remaining dry mix. Bake uncovered (I covered it) at 350 degrees for one hour. Serve warm.
